Marilyn Frauenkron Bayer - Keynote Speaker
" Making the Most of Your Garden Outdoor Living Space" Learn ways to make your garden a destination and enjoy it to the fullest.
Marilyn is a retired community education director, with a BA in geology, a National Community Education Fellow, who is a graduate of the Blandin Community Leadership Program and the Blandin Academy for Advancing Community. Most recently she has served as a consultant in seven states, on asset based community development. Recognitions have included Minnesota Community Educator of the Year, The Environmental Award for Individuals Outstanding Contribution to the Environment of Houston County and the Appreciation Award for Volunteer Community Service in Preserving the Natural Beauty of Houston County.
